javascript函数输出任意个数的范围数组

javascript函数输出任意个数的范围数组_第1张图片
示意图

//   生成一个区间范围内数值
function getRandom(start,end){
    if( typeof start === "number" && typeof end === "number"){
        return Math.ceil(Math.random()*(end-start)) + start 
    }else{
        throw new Error("arguments must be a number")
    }       
}

//    生成符合数量和区间范围的数组
function pick(num,start,end){
    if(typeof num === "number"){
        var result = []
        var arr = []
        var distance = end - start   // 区间值之间的差额数量

        !function innerPick(){        
            for(var i=0; i

你可能感兴趣的:(javascript函数输出任意个数的范围数组)